English: Koothambalam is attached to fourteen major temples of Kerala. Koothambalam is an auditorium to perform temple arts especially Koothu. The picture shows the Koothambalam of Irringalakuda (Sangama Grahmam) Koodal Manikya Temple and is considered as the second largest Koothambalam in size.
